About (3S,4S)-1-(2-methylpyrimidin-4-yl)-4-(trifluoromethyl)pyrrolidine-3-carboxylic acid
(3S,4S)-1-(2-methylpyrimidin-4-yl)-4-(trifluoromethyl)pyrrolidine-3-carboxylic acid (PubChem CID 122063825) has the molecular formula C11H12F3N3O2
and a molecular weight of 275.23 g/mol. Its IUPAC name is (3S,4S)-1-(2-methylpyrimidin-4-yl)-4-(trifluoromethyl)pyrrolidine-3-carboxylic acid.

What is the SMILES notation for (3S,4S)-1-(2-methylpyrimidin-4-yl)-4-(trifluoromethyl)pyrrolidine-3-carboxylic acid?
The canonical SMILES for (3S,4S)-1-(2-methylpyrimidin-4-yl)-4-(trifluoromethyl)pyrrolidine-3-carboxylic acid is Cc1nccc(N2C[C@@H](C(F)(F)F)[C@H](C(=O)O)C2)n1.
What is the InChIKey of (3S,4S)-1-(2-methylpyrimidin-4-yl)-4-(trifluoromethyl)pyrrolidine-3-carboxylic acid?
The InChIKey is QRNYSVBAVGREBV-HTQZYQBOSA-N. The full InChI is InChI=1S/C11H12F3N3O2/c1-6-15-3-2-9(16-6)17-4-7(10(18)19)8(5-17)11(12,13)14/h2-3,7-8H,4-5H2,1H3,(H,18,19)/t7-,8-/m1/s1.
What are the key properties of (3S,4S)-1-(2-methylpyrimidin-4-yl)-4-(trifluoromethyl)pyrrolidine-3-carboxylic acid?
(3S,4S)-1-(2-methylpyrimidin-4-yl)-4-(trifluoromethyl)pyrrolidine-3-carboxylic acid has a molecular weight of 275.23 g/mol, XLogP of 1.48, 2 rotatable bonds, 1 hydrogen bond donors, and 4 hydrogen bond acceptors.
